The Nets are on a winning streak. They took care of business Friday night in Miami with a comfortable win over the Heat. The Nets took the lead early, held the Heat to just 10 second-quarter points, and led by 12 at the half. Miami cut the lead down to four midway through the third, but the Nets took back control and were never threatened after that. Richard Jefferson carried the offensive load, scoring 25 points on 11-of-19 shooting. Vince Carter shot just 5-of-14 from the field, but finished three assists short of a triple-double, while Jason Kidd added 11 points, 12 assists and 4 steals. Jason Collins did indeed play and scored six points in 19 minutes.
